RCBC is a very stable bank bro. Pacific Plans is just a sister company of the bank and is under their pre-need, insurance and investments division.
RCBC is a commercial bank and is considered #4 among the commercial banks. Meaning, 4th biggest bank sya in the phils.
Pacific Plans (PPI) is a pre-need firm and is not related with the banking system of RCBC. Pre-need industry fell last 1987 when the government deregulated the tution fees of the private schools in the country. Di ra man ang pacific plans ang na down, almost tanan man sa pre-need firms like CAP. However, pacific plans is still present in the market right now unlike CAP, so meaning Pacific Plans is still earning (that is why it is bought by Zest-O corp). Sa issues why wala pa kabayad ang pacific plans sa plan holders is because of the TRO of PET Coalition sa Pacific Plans because return of premiums ra ang kaya pay sa PPI.
